This Strawberry Compote Filling for Cupcakes is sweet, vibrant, and bursting with fresh strawberry flavor. Made with simple ingredients and ready in minutes, this homemade strawberry compote adds a juicy, fruity center to vanilla, chocolate, or lemon cupcakes. It’s the perfect natural filling that tastes fresh, bright, and beautifully balanced — no artificial flavors, just real strawberries cooked gently into a luscious, spoonable compote.
Ingredients
- 2 cups fresh strawberries, finely chopped
- 1/3 cup granulated sugar
- 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ch
- 2 tablespoons water
- 1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- Pinch of salt
Instructions
- Wash, hull, and finely chop the fresh strawberries.
- Add the strawberries and sugar to a small saucepan over medium heat.
- Stir gently and cook for 5–7 minutes until the strawberries release their juices and begin to soften.
- In a small bowl, mix the cornstarch and water until smooth to create a slurry.
- Pour the slurry into the saucepan and stir continuously to prevent lumps.
- Add the lemon juice, lemon zest, and a pinch of salt.
- Cook for another 2–3 minutes until the mixture thickens into a glossy compote.
- Remove from heat and stir in the vanilla extract.
- Allow the compote to cool completely before using it to fill cupcakes.
- Core the center of each cupcake and spoon about 1 tablespoon of compote into the center before frosting.
Notes
Use ripe, sweet strawberries for the best flavor. If strawberries are very sweet, reduce the sugar slightly. You can substitute frozen strawberries — thaw and drain excess liquid first. Store the compote in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days. The compote can also be frozen for up to 2 months. Always let it cool fully before filling cupcakes to prevent melting the frosting.
